Primary Functions and Responsibilities:

The Quality Manager will deliver measurable and sustainable results by leading the quality department(s), responsible and accountable for site quality performance in St. Louis and Lavergne. The Quality Manager will drive initiatives that support key objectives and strategies for our operations and will drive and own any future certification processes as well as continued compliance processes.

  • Drive quality expectations process throughout the business through “hands-on” support
  • Ensure potential needed compliance/certification processes such as Good Manufacturing Practices, SQF program, and QMS as we align across multiple facilities
  • Ensure customer quality standards are clear, documented, sent to customers as required and records are maintained
  • Manages QA staff to effectively increase the quality of our products
  • Collaborates on the transfer of work from facilities to proactively mitigate quality risks
  • Issue RMA’s, coordinate investigations and respond with corrective and preventive actions CAPA for any customer complaints emphasizing error proofing related processes
  • Facilitates root cause analysis of both internal and external issues
  • Coordinates actions for quality-related credits including approvals and associated actions with stakeholders across the business
  • Coach and champion functions to identify and implement opportunities to improve program and process effectiveness
  • Monitor progress of key initiatives to check if changes yield desirable results
  • Establish measurable standards at the start of a project and then compare actual project results against these, regularly generating detailed update reports to key stake holders
  • Act as a technical expert, coach and train other team members in problem solving and risk mitigation
  • Deploy the appropriate Quality/Delivery/Cost metrics and management routines at all levels of the organization
  • Collaboration with Quality Managers from other locations on companywide projects
  • Create value stream and/or process maps to help standardize process and workflow where necessary

Brook & Whittle Ltd. is one of North America’s leading Sustainable Labeling Solutions providers, producing pressure sensitive labels, shrink sleeves and flexible packaging for many of the nation’s leading brands. The company serves multiple consumer markets, including Personal Care, Beverage, Food, Nutraceuticals, Wine & Spirits, and Household Chemicals.
